I have seen wonderful hardwood floor patterns utilized by members in the image gallery, yet I cannot find any realistic wood grains or hardwood floor patterns within my accurender materials list.

You will need to create a material.
Best bet is to start at: www.accustudio.com and download their material library. They also have many material textures you can incorporate into a Revit material.
There are also a ton of other sites on the web. A google search of the web and a search of this site should yield more results.
